Ingredients

Main Ingredients
- 8 lasagna noodles, cooked
- 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
- 1 cup cottage cheese
- 1 cup marinara sauce
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
Optional Add-Ins
- Fresh spinach for added greens
- Red pepper flakes for a little heat
- Ricotta in place of cottage cheese for a classic twist
- Extra Parmesan for a stronger cheesy flavor

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Prepare the Oven and Pan
Preheat your oven to 375°F and grease a muffin pan thoroughly to prevent sticking.
2. Make the Chicken Filling
In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, cottage cheese, half of the mozzarella, Parmesan, garlic, Italian seasoning, and black pepper. Mix until creamy and evenly combined.
3. Shape the Noodle Cups
Cut the cooked lasagna noodles into strips if needed. Press them into each muffin cup, forming a small shell that lines the bottom and sides.
4. Add Oil for Crispiness
Lightly brush the noodle edges with olive oil. This helps them crisp up and turn golden during baking.
5. Layer the Filling
Spoon a small amount of marinara sauce into each cup, then add the chicken mixture. Top with a little more marinara and finish with the remaining mozzarella cheese.
6. Bake Until Golden
Bake for 18 to 22 minutes, until the cheese is melted, bubbly, and lightly golden on top.
7. Rest and Serve
Let the lasagna cups rest for about 5 minutes before removing them from the pan. This helps them hold their shape.
Pro Tips for Best Results
- Cook noodles just until al dente so they hold structure
- Grease the muffin pan very well to prevent sticking
- Do not overfill the cups to keep them intact
- Let them rest before removing for cleaner presentation
- Use freshly grated Parmesan for better flavor
- Add a little extra cheese on top for a golden finish

Variations to Try
Spinach Garlic Version
Add chopped spinach to the filling for extra freshness and nutrition.
Spicy Version
Add red pepper flakes or a bit of hot sauce for heat.
Extra Cheesy Version
Use a mix of mozzarella, cheddar, and Parmesan for a richer flavor.
Low-Carb Option
Use thin zucchini slices instead of noodles.
Alfredo Style
Swap marinara for Alfredo sauce for a creamy white version.
Storage and Reheating
Refrigeration
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Freezing
Freeze individual cups for up to 2 months.
Reheating
Reheat in the oven or air fryer for best texture. Microwave works for quick reheating but softens the edges.

FAQs
Can I use rotisserie chicken
Yes, it works perfectly and saves time.
Can I substitute cottage cheese
Yes, ricotta is a great alternative.
How do I keep them from sticking
Grease the muffin pan thoroughly and let them cool slightly before removing.
Can I make them ahead of time
Yes, assemble them ahead and bake when ready.
Are they good for meal prep
Absolutely, they reheat well and keep their flavor.
